Carechoice Ardmore, Finglas Road, Finglas South, Dublin 11
GRANT PERMISSIONPlanning application 2614/20
Dublin - Dublin City Council
Proposed Development
Planning Permission to install 6 no. antenna and 2 no. transmission dishes on existing supporting poles together with equipment cabinets, cabling and associated site works at the roof level of Carechoice Ardmore, Finglas Road, Finglas South, Dublin D11 X4YP.
